Local Authority & Enforcement in Beverley

Humberside Fire and Rescue Service enforces fire safety in Beverley on behalf of East Riding of Yorkshire. Under the Regulatory Reform (Fire Safety) Order 2005 and the Fire Safety (England) Regulations 2022, responsible persons must ensure a suitable and sufficient fire risk assessment. Buildings over 11m require monthly flat entrance-door checks and quarterly common-parts checks.

Common Mistakes in Beverley

  • East Riding of Yorkshire assuming Humberside Fire and Rescue Service will inspect on their behalf — the duty to hold a suitable and sufficient assessment sits with the responsible person, not the fire and rescue service.
  • Forgetting that common parts (stairs, corridors, shared kitchens) require an FRA under Article 9 of the RRO 2005 even where rooms are let individually
  • Mixed-use buildings (shop below, flats above) where the commercial and residential responsible persons fail to co-ordinate
  • Buildings over 11m where monthly flat entrance-door checks are a legal duty under the Fire Safety (England) Regulations 2022
  • Not reviewing the assessment after refurbishment, change of use, or new equipment

Do I legally need a fire risk assessment in Beverley?

Yes. Under Article 9 of the Regulatory Reform (Fire Safety) Order 2005, the responsible person for any non-domestic premises in Beverley must have a suitable and sufficient fire risk assessment and keep it up to date. Humberside Fire and Rescue Service is the enforcing fire and rescue authority for Beverley, but the duty to hold the assessment sits with the responsible person — not with Humberside Fire and Rescue Service.
